Background technology
The natural leathers such as ox-hide are thicker, in order to improve the utilization rate of leather in leather making process, usually cut open into two-layer even more multi-layered.Ground floor section leather is for the manufacture of top grade leather leather after top finishing, and the second layer and following section leather (abbreviation split leather) thereof are without superficial makings layer, and aesthetic property and practicality are removed from office not as good as ground floor.Past general by sanding, dye and double-layer fur made " chamois leather ", namely our said two layers of suede, it belongs to more low-grade product.The production principle of polyurethane (PU) artificial leather was applied to leather and cutd open in the production of layer afterwards, last layer PU is added to split leather surface by the production method of PU transfer, make it that both there is the hygroscopicity of corium, the advantage of dimensionally stable, there is again the advantage of PU artificial leather water proofing property and wearability.Adopt the leather produced in this way and be called transfer-film leather, also namely transfer-film leather is that PU removes from office the product combined with corium.The class of transfer-film leather is better than synthetic leather and artificial leather, and price is lower than the leather made with ox-hide section leather ground floor, is applicable to manufacture footwear, belt, handbag, bag etc.
Time together with split leather is compound to artificial leather, need to use equipment complex.Be 201320300497x in China Patent No., authorized announcement date be November 27 in 2013 day, be called in the patent document of " the hot pressure equipment complex of TPU hot melt film and synthetic leather " and announced a kind of leather equipment complex.Existing leather equipment complex has the following disadvantages: can only be used in the production that synthesis layer is all the leather of non-individual body, and the split leather in transfer-film leather is be in off-state one by one.In addition in the recombination process of transfer-film leather, when split leather is placed on artificial leather, easily produce fold foaming phenomena.
Utility model content
The utility model provide a kind of can complete transfer-film leather compound and split leather is not easy to produce the transfer-film leather set composite of fold foaming phenomena, solve split leather in transfer-film leather recombination process and easily produce the problem that fold foaming phenomena and existing composite structure can not adapt to the compound of transfer-film leather.
Above technical problem is solved by following technical proposal: a kind of transfer-film leather set composite, comprise frame, described frame is provided with transport platform, pressure roller, split leather stacks platform, split leather conveyer belt and comb flattening mechanism, composite channel is formed between described transport platform and pressure roller, described pressure roller, split leather conveyer belt and split leather stack platform three and distribute successively, the below that described split leather stacks platform and split leather conveyer belt is provided with feeding-passage, described comb flattening mechanism comprises the flat rod of comb be positioned at above split leather conveyer belt, the flat rod of described comb comprises roll body, described roll body one end side face on helical ring be wound with isolated first raised band in some roads, on the side face of the other end, helical ring is wound with isolated second raised band in some roads, described first raised band and the second raised band contrary around direction, the bearing of trend of described first raised band near one end of described second raised band is contrary with the direction of rotation of the flat rod of described comb, the bearing of trend of described second raised band near one end of described first raised band is contrary with the direction of rotation of the flat rod of described comb.In use procedure, artificial leather enters composite channel from feeding-passage, split leather is layered in split leather and stacks on platform, split leather is put on split leather conveyer belt by artificial or equipment one by one, split leather is delivered in composite channel by split leather conveyer belt one by one, split leather and artificial leather coordinate the squeezing action of transport platform through composite channel at pressure roller and are combined with each other, when split leather is between the flat rod of comb and split leather conveyer belt, under the effect of the raised band of horizontal roller, width along split leather conveyer belt is extruded from the middle to both ends further, play and split leather fully shakeout and extrudes the effect of foaming, thus the fold number that produces of split leather in the transfer-film leather making compound go out and foam number are effectively reduced.
As preferably, the quantity of described first raised band and the second raised band is equal, and described first raised band and the second raised band link together correspondingly.More reliably split leather fully can be shakeout, centre can not be produced and stay alveolate phenomenon.
As preferably, described first raised band and the second raised band are all made up of bristle.When the thickness evenness difference of split leather, also impression can not be produced on split leather surface.
As preferably, described comb flattening mechanism also comprises the first motor driving the flat rod of described comb to rotate.Comb flat rod can not produce stall and lose the effect of shakeouing.
As preferably, described comb flattening mechanism also comprises the flat rod cantilever of comb, one end of described comb flat rod cantilever is hinged with described frame, and the flat rod of described comb is rotationally connected with the other end of the flat rod cantilever of described comb, and the middle part of described comb flat rod cantilever is by supporting cylinder supports in described frame.The gap achieved between the flat rod of comb and split leather conveyer belt is adjustable.Versatility is good.
As preferably, described split leather conveyer belt is provided with the tilt feeding section of downward-sloping feeding near one end of described pressure roller.Can be more smooth-going and easily split leather is transported in composite channel, prevent split leather from transferring to from split leather conveyer belt and produce twisting the process of composite channel and cause producing fold.
As preferably, the flat rod of described comb is positioned at above described tilt feeding section.Shakeout effective.
As preferably, one end that described split leather conveyer belt stacks platform near described split leather is provided with straight feeding section.Can improve and split leather is stacked convenience when platform is transferred to split leather conveyer belt from split leather.
The utility model has following advantage: the compound that can complete transfer-film leather; The split leather surface of the transfer-film leather that compound goes out is not easy to produce fold and foaming phenomena.
